How namy pci slots can you insert in PC?

You cannot actually insert pci slots into a PC since pci slots come inbuilt on the motherboard. so the no. of pci slots u have depends on the motherboard.

How many periphial slots does a motherboard have?

That's completely individual.Most motherboards will have an AGP slot and at least three PCI slots.They rarely have more than five PCI slots

What is the expansion for the acronym PCI X?

PCI X stands for Peripheral Component Interconnect Extended. It is used for expansion of 32 bit PCI bus slots. The slots are used to enhance the capabilities of the motherboard.


How can you install a graphics card on an Intel D945GCPE motherboard?

As the motherboard has only two expansion slots, both PCI, your options are rather limited. You would need to purchase a PCI graphics card, which probably isn't worth the money.
